The O'Brien Black Magic Towable Kneeboard is designed to suit riders of all skill levels, making it a versatile choice whether you’re just starting out or looking to try new tricks. Its symmetric twin tip shape helps with balance and allows you to progress into more advanced maneuvers. The plastic material is durable and suitable for lake or river use, though it may feel heavier compared to boards made from lighter composites.
Comfort is a strong point thanks to the premium molded EVA pad, which combines softness with firm support for your knees during long rides. The 3-inch padded strap is adjustable and provides a secure fit, helping you stay in control without discomfort. One standout feature is the cable-actuated retractable fins, which you can raise for easier spins or lower for sharper turns, giving you flexibility in how you ride. The removable aquatic hook adds convenience by making it easier to start on the water, but you can take it off if you prefer.
Measuring about 52.75 inches long and weighing 15.3 pounds, it’s fairly standard in size but might be a bit heavy for some users to carry around. A one-year manufacturer warranty adds peace of mind. If you want a reliable and comfortable kneeboard that supports skill growth and offers adjustable ride options, the O'Brien Black Magic is a solid pick. Those seeking an ultra-lightweight or high-tech material board may find this model somewhat basic.
The O'Brien VooDoo Kneeboard is designed for a wide range of users, from kids to adults, offering versatile performance. Its standout feature is the aqua-hook, which simplifies starts by allowing the rope to attach to the board, making it easier to get up on the water. The board's quad molded fins at each corner enhance stability, providing better tracking and edge control. This makes it a reliable choice for both aggressive and forgiving rides.
Additionally, the curved underside aids in smooth edge transitions, adding to the stability and control. Comfort is another strong point, thanks to the 3/4” thick pad that cushions your knees and ankles. The quick-release 3-inch padded strap helps keep you securely fastened, ensuring maximum control during rides.
Made from plastic, the VooDoo Kneeboard is durable, though it might not be as lightweight as some other materials. Weighing 12.65 pounds, it is relatively easy to handle. The black/blue color scheme is visually appealing. For general use and versatile performance, the O'Brien VooDoo Kneeboard is a solid option, especially for those prioritizing ease of use and comfort.
The SereneLife Water Sport Kneeboard SLKB20 is designed for a variety of water activities, making it a versatile choice for both kids and adults. It stands out with its durable construction, using marine-grade materials that are corrosion-proof and built to last. At just under 9 lbs, it is lightweight and easy to transport, which is a significant advantage for users needing to carry it to and from the water.
The board includes an adjustable strap, enhancing safety and making it ideal for dynamic activities such as boating and knee surfing. Its 50-inch length and 20-inch width provide a good fit for older children, teens, and adults, making it a universally accommodating option. On the downside, the product dimensions might be a bit bulky for very young children to handle comfortably.
The SereneLife SLKB20 is a solid choice for those looking for a durable, lightweight, and safe kneeboard for a range of water sport activities.
